Job description

Industrial Electrician:

Schedule (7 am – 3 pm) and rotating to 12 hrs. every 4 weeks after trained. 12 hours shift will be primarily 7 am – 7 pm. There may be an occasional night shift 7 pm – 7 am but rare.

Starting hourly payrate $31.30 - $41.75 per hour

Role & Responsibilities:
  • Work safely as a top priority by adhering to the plant’s accident prevention policies. Maintain safe and clean working environment by complying with procedures, rules, and regulations.
  • Safely install, perform preventive maintenance, and troubleshoot electrical components within the manufacturing plant.
  • Maintain, test and repair AC/DC motors and motor control systems.
  • Develop skill set to troubleshoot advanced control system and instrumentation equipment including PLC controls.
  • Interpret and use wiring schematics.
  • Operate electrical test equipment inherent to the job.
  • Know and understand NEC codes, become trained in NFPA-70E, and practice all other electrician duties in a manufacturing environment
Qualifications & Requirements:
  • Must have the desired technical skills to safely and proficiently work as an electrician in a plant setting.
  • Possess basic mechanical maintenance skills.
  • Ability to interpret and perform tasks as detailed on printed work orders.
  • Basic computer skills needed to complete safety training and review work-related email.
  • Ability to operate equipment as needed, including forklifts, etc.
  • Familiar with common hand tools and how to properly use them.
  • Good collaboration skills and ability to work as part of a team.

USG employees enjoy a number of benefit options for themselves and their families. These include two medical insurance options, as well as vision and dental coverage. The cost of these optional programs varies based on coverage level - employees generally pay 25% of the monthly premium cost, USG pays the rest. These coverage options are offered on the first day of employment with no waiting period.

Additionally, USG employees enjoy both a 401(k) Investment Plan with company match and a pension plan. Beyond these main features, employees may also choose from a number of additional programs like life insurance, accident insurance, legal insurance, even pet insurance, just to name a few. USG also offers Quarterly (hourly) / Annual (salary) bonus potential for all employees based on performance metrics tied to safety, quality, and productivity.USG also provides employees with paid time off and paid holidays.
